4 tips to help you do well on your driving test

The anticipation of an upcoming driving test is enough to make even the most confident drivers feel a little nervous. The good news is that passing the test and earning your driver's licence is entirely within your control. Just follow these 4 tips and you are guaranteed to do well.

1. Practice, Practice, Practice Good driving, like any other skill, takes a lot of practice. Practice with a good friend or relative who you know is safe and experienced behind the wheel, and invest your time and money in professional lessons as well. Feeling comfortable in the driver's seat is an absolute must if you want to pass your driving test. 2. Use a Car You Are Comfortable In Try to get as much practice as you can driving the car that you intend to use during your exam. Every car handles a little differently, and you don't want to be caught off guard on test day in an unfamiliar vehicle, especially if you plan on driving manual transmission. 3. Familiarize Yourself with the Testing Area Driving tests are often conducted on the roads in the immediate vicinity of your chosen testing centre. Once you book your test, it is a great idea to spend some time driving around these roads and familiarizing yourself with the area. Take note of road hazards, speed limits, playground zones, and any other important road signs. 4. Fix Your Bad Driving Habits before the Test Before taking your driving test it is important to recognize and drop some of the bad driving habits that keep people from passing. These habits include but are certainly not limited to: not having your hands at 10 and 2, failing to shoulder check, speeding, following too closely behind other cars, and not coming to a full stop at stop signs. Fix your bad habits before test day and you'll have no problem getting your license.
